The Slovenian government is encouraging LOT Polish Airlines to increase the frequency of flights on the route from Warsaw to Ljubljana and to launch new connections from the Slovenian capital.
The website exyuaviation.com has published information about talks between the Slovenian government and LOT Polish Airlines. What were they about? According to the article, representatives of the Slovenian authorities encouraged LOT to increase the frequency of flights on the Warsaw-Ljubljana route and even launch new connections from the Slovenian capital. According to the authors of the article, LOT is particularly interested in this prospect, but in talks with the Polish media, the Polish national airline's office is cooling down emotions and emphasising that any decisions will be made in the distant future and will remain a priority.
